Pastoral Care Coordinator Come join us at St. Patrick's Manor! A Faith-Based, Nonprofit, 303-bed, Short and Long-term care facility sponsored by the Carmelite Sisters. We are a place of life, a place of caring, and more importantly, a true home for our residents. Located on lush, manicured lawns and gardens in Framingham, MA, we are just minutes from Route 9 for easy access to the Mass Pike. We are seeking candidates for position of: Pastoral Care Coordinator . 32 Hours per week. $21 to $26 per hour based on skills and experience.
Pastoral Care Coordinator Qualifications:
Associate degree, Bachelor's degree preferred with some background in theology. Professional knowledge and understanding of the Ethical and Religious Directives for Catholic Healthcare. Experienced or Certified Extraordinary Minister of the Eucharist and Lector. Active member of a Roman Catholic parish, preferred Experience in spiritual programming. Excellent communication skills. Ability to work with a team. Working computer knowledge. Employee recognition or event planning
Pastoral Care Coordinator Job Summary:
Responsible for initial and ongoing assessment of each resident to determine his/her spiritual needs. Provide pastoral visits to residents and spiritual support to families and staff. Offer extra support to residents in the dying process and arranges hospitality carts for their families as needed. Arrange for Mass as often as possible and resident anointing on a bi-annual basis if possible. Develop spiritual programming for Roman Catholic residents such as communion services, communal rosary, Bible study. Arrange for visits by clergy of other faiths as requested by non- Catholic residents. Participate as Member of Ethics and QAPI Committees. Attend Care Plan meetings and morning report. Employee recognition/event planning as part of mission integration other duties assigned by supervisor This is a brief overview of job responsibilities and not intended to be all inclusive.
